Cauldron Cookies Ingredients & Substitutions

  • Chocolate cookies or sandwich cookies: Use store-bought for convenience or bake homemade if you prefer.
  • Black candy melts or dark chocolate: Creates the cauldron effect. You can also use frosting if candy melts are unavailable.
  • Mini peanut butter cups: Form the base of the cauldron. Substitute with small chocolate truffles.
  • Green frosting or icing: Represents the bubbling potion. Swap with melted green candy or tinted buttercream.
  • Mini colorful candies: Think mini M&Ms, sprinkles, or candy pearls for the β€œmagic ingredients.”
  • Pretzel sticks: For stirring wands. You could also use licorice pieces.

Step-by-Step Instructions to Make Cauldron Cookies

  1. Line a baking sheet with parchment paper.
  2. Place the mini peanut butter cups upside down on the sheet to create the cauldron base.
  3. Attach a chocolate cookie on top using a dab of melted chocolate as glue.
  4. Spread green frosting or icing in the center of each cookie.
  5. Add mini colorful candies to look like bubbling magic potions.
  6. Place a pretzel stick next to each cookie for the stirring wand.
  7. Let everything set for 10 to 15 minutes before serving.

Tips for Success

  • Chill the cookies briefly after decorating to help the chocolate set quickly.
  • Use a piping bag or zip-top bag for neat green frosting swirls.
  • Mix up your β€œpotions” with candy eyeballs or gummy worms for extra spookiness.

Variations of Cauldron Cookies

  • Gluten-Free: Use gluten-free cookies and pretzel sticks.
  • Colorful Cauldrons: Try purple, orange, or blue frosting instead of green.
  • Mini Cauldrons: Use bite-sized sandwich cookies for smaller treats.
  • Extra Chocolatey: Drizzle melted white chocolate over the top for a potion overflow look.

Storage & Reheating Instructions

  • Storage: Keep cookies in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 4 days.
  • Refrigeration: Store in the fridge for a firmer texture, up to 1 week.
  • Freezing: Freeze undecorated bases, then add frosting and candies after thawing.

FAQs

Can I make Cauldron Cookies ahead of time?
Yes, prepare the cookie bases in advance and decorate them the day you plan to serve for the freshest look.

What frosting works best for the potion effect?
A simple buttercream or store-bought frosting tinted with gel food coloring works perfectly. Candy melts also give a smooth finish.

Can kids help with this recipe?
Absolutely. Kids love decorating and adding the candy β€œpotions.” Just be sure an adult handles the melted chocolate step.

Ingredients
  

Main Ingredients

  • 12 mini peanut butter cups used as cauldron base
  • 12 chocolate cookies or sandwich cookies store-bought or homemade
  • Β½ cup black candy melts or dark chocolate for glue
  • Β½ cup green frosting or icing tinted buttercream or melted green candy
  • ΒΌ cup mini colorful candies like M&Ms, sprinkles, or candy pearls
  • 12 pretzel sticks for stirring wands

Instructions
 

  • Line a baking sheet with parchment paper.
  • Place mini peanut butter cups upside down to form the base of each cauldron.
  • Attach a chocolate cookie on top of each peanut butter cup using a dab of melted chocolate.
  • Pipe or spread green frosting in the center of each cookie to resemble bubbling potion.
  • Top with mini candies to mimic magic ingredients.
  • Place a pretzel stick beside each cookie as a stirring wand.
  • Allow to set for 10–15 minutes before serving or storing.
